Imaging/vtkImageEuclideanToPolar.h
Go to the documentation of this file.00001
00002
00003
00004
00005
00006
00007
00008
00009
00010
00011
00012
00013
00014
00015
00040 #ifndef __vtkImageEuclideanToPolar_h
00041 #define __vtkImageEuclideanToPolar_h
00042
00043
00044 #include "vtkImageToImageFilter.h"
00045
00046 class VTK_IMAGING_EXPORT vtkImageEuclideanToPolar : public vtkImageToImageFilter
00047 {
00048 public:
00049 static vtkImageEuclideanToPolar *New();
00050 vtkTypeRevisionMacro(vtkImageEuclideanToPolar,vtkImageToImageFilter);
00051 void PrintSelf(ostream& os, vtkIndent indent);
00052
00054
00057 vtkSetMacro(ThetaMaximum,float);
00058 vtkGetMacro(ThetaMaximum,float);
00060
00061 protected:
00062 vtkImageEuclideanToPolar();
00063 ~vtkImageEuclideanToPolar() {};
00064
00065 float ThetaMaximum;
00066
00067 void ThreadedExecute(vtkImageData *inData, vtkImageData *outData,
00068 int ext[6], int id);
00069 private:
00070 vtkImageEuclideanToPolar(const vtkImageEuclideanToPolar&);
00071 void operator=(const vtkImageEuclideanToPolar&);
00072 };
00073
00074 #endif
00075
00076
00077